Stonecrop - Hardy Perennial. Stonecrop sedum ( Sedum spurium) is an extremely hardy, low-growing perennial ground cover for sun and heat. It reaches just 4-6 inches tall but spreads 1-2 feet wide. The leaves are blue-green or bronze-red. Showy clusters of pink or white starry flowers bloom from summer into fall.

Sweet alyssum is drought-tolerant, frost-resistant, and heat-resistant, and it grows well in just about any soil. For best results, plant sweet alyssum in full sun or partial shade. It reaches only 8-12 inches high and makes a pretty ground cover, especially in flowerbeds and along walkways.

This sun-loving and drought-tolerant variety of catmint makes for a great flowering ground cover. 'Six Hills Giant' has a mounding growth habit and bears numerous small flowers. If you cut it back after its first bloom, it should flower for most of the growing season. Its leaves fill the air with a lemony scent when they're brushed or bruised.

1. Lantana This common ground cover is easy to find at garden centers and home improvement stores. It requires very little care, loves the sun, and is drought tolerant once established. There are dozens of varieties from which to choose, and this flowering perennial is available with white, yellow, orange, red, pink, or blue blossoms.

01 of 15 'Angelina' Sedum Blaine Moats You can't go wrong with 'Angelina' sedum ( Sedum rupestre ). This extra-easy perennial thrives in hot, sunny locations, even in the cracks in a dry stack stone wall. 'Angelina' develops tidy, needle-like, chartreuse foliage highlighted by bright yellow flowers throughout the summer.

Height: 3 to 6 inches. Creeping thyme ( Thymus serpyllum) is an excellent drought-tolerant, low-maintenance ground cover plant. It forms a dense mat of small, fragrant leaves, creating a beautiful carpet-like effect. It also produces small, delicate flowers in various colors, including pink, purple, and white, which add to its visual appeal.

Drought Tolerant Groundcovers for Sun Popular sun-loving groundcovers that tolerate drought include: Rockrose ( Cistus spp.) - Rockrose has lush, gray-green foliage and colorful blooms of various shades of pink, purple, white, and rose. Zones 8 through 11.
